Integrating STEM Education With Local Culture in Indonesia: Teachers’ Perspective and Practice

Abstract

STEM education based on local culture produces a more contextual and meaningful learning experience for students. However, the practical implementation has led to numerous issues. The study aims to describe the challenges teachers face in implementing STEM education based on local culture and explore the teacher practice related to understanding and teaching strategies in STEM education. The total participants were 143 teachers who taught science, social, and other subjects. The data were collected using the survey method and analyzed with descriptive statistics. The results show that 51% of teachers answered that integrating local culture into learning is essential because it can preserve local culture and introduce culture to the younger generation by presenting contextual learning. However, 59.4% of teachers have never applied STEM in learning, and 40.6% of teachers are still confused about its application, even though they have heard of STEM before. The data indicated that the teachers faced many challenges regarding their understanding, practical constraints, teaching strategies, and STEM integrated with local wisdom. Notably, the findings show that most teachers have a lack of understanding of how to link STEM education and local contextual values. The strategy of integrating culture into learning is considered the most effective if it is done by developing teaching materials based on STEM. The implications of teaching strategies of STEM education related to local wisdom are discussed.
